Choosing a Wall Light: Up-Down, Wall Washer and IP Rating

Up-down or one-way? When is a wall washer needed, and at what height is it mounted?

Ceiling lighting lights a room as a whole; a wall light washes the surface and gives it depth and texture. If a room has only a ceiling fitting, the walls stay dark and the space looks smaller than it is. A wall light closes exactly that gap — but which model suits where depends on the shape of the body and the distribution of the light.

Up-down or one-way?

An up-down fitting sends light in both directions at once: a symmetrical band of brightness forms on the wall and the fitting itself becomes a design element. Used in a row along a corridor it creates a rhythmic effect.

A one-way fitting sends light in a single direction — usually upwards. In rooms with low ceilings, light thrown at the ceiling creates indirect illumination that does not tire the eye. On staircases, directing the light downwards is the safer choice for the steps.

  • Up-down: corridor, living room, hotel lobby — symmetrical and decorative.
  • One-way up: low ceilings, bedrooms — indirect and soft.
  • One-way down: staircases, entrances — safety on steps and floor.

When is a wall washer the right choice?

A wall washer spreads light evenly along a surface. A spot emphasises a point; a wall washer lights the whole wall from end to end at the same intensity.

If there is a textured wall, stone cladding or a picture wall, a wall washer brings that surface forward as a whole. On a facade it washes the entire building and sharpens its silhouette at night.

The distance to the wall determines the evenness: place the fitting too close and you get a bright band at the top and darkness below. The general rule is to set the fitting away from the wall by about a quarter of the ceiling height.

Mounting height

The height of a wall light follows one principle: the light must not reach the eye directly. In living rooms and corridors, 180–200 cm from the floor keeps it above the eye level of a standing person and prevents glare.

For bedside fittings the criterion differs: the shoulder height of a person sitting up in bed is the reference, and a range of 120–140 cm from the floor suits reading. On staircases, 150–170 cm above the step both lights the step and keeps the eye comfortable.

Outdoors the IP rating decides

Use an indoor fitting outside and moisture gets into the body, and the electronics fail before long. On every fitting used outdoors the IP rating must be checked.

A body rated IP65 or above can be exposed directly to rain; in sheltered places such as under an eave, IP44 may be enough. In coastal areas with salt in the air the body material also matters — an aluminium body does not rust.

The two digits of an IP code describe different things: the first covers protection against solid objects (dust), the second against water. In IP65, the 6 means complete dust-tightness and the 5 means resistance to water jets from any direction. On a fitting that will meet a hose during garden watering, that second digit is the decisive one.

How many fittings, at what spacing?

Wall lights show their effect when used as a row rather than singly. In a corridor the spacing depends on the ceiling height and the beam angle of the fitting: with a standard ceiling of 2.4–2.7 m, a spacing of 2–2.5 m gives a balanced rhythm in most cases. As the spacing opens up, dark gaps appear on the wall and the row of light looks broken.

In a living room a single fitting does not provide general lighting; its job is to emphasise a surface or a corner. General lighting should come from the ceiling, with the wall light adding a layer on top. Substituting one for the other produces either glare or too little light.

Symmetry is read immediately by eye: with an even number of fittings on a wall they are spaced equally; with an odd number the middle one falls on the centre. Leaving equal distances to door and window edges completes the arrangement.

Types of wall light

TypeLight distributionBest suited toWatch out for
Up-downSymmetrical, both directionsCorridor, living room, lobbyLeaves a mark on the wall — the surface must be flat
One-way (up)Indirect, onto the ceilingLow ceilings, bedroomsDoes not provide general lighting on its own
One-way (down)Direct, onto the floorStaircases, entrancesHeight is set relative to the step
Wall washerEven along the surfaceTextured wall, facadeDistance to the wall determines evenness

Frequently Asked Questions

At what height is a wall light mounted?

In living rooms and corridors it is mounted 180–200 cm from the floor, so that it stays above the eye level of a standing person. For bedside fittings, 120–140 cm from the floor suits reading; on staircases, 150–170 cm above the step both lights the step and avoids glare.

What is the difference between an up-down and a one-way fitting?

An up-down fitting sends light in both directions at once and forms a symmetrical band of brightness on the wall; in corridors and living rooms it creates a decorative effect. A one-way fitting sends light in a single direction — indirect and soft when aimed upwards, suited to floor safety when aimed downwards.

What is the difference between a wall washer and a spot?

A spot emphasises a point, while a wall washer lights the whole wall from end to end at the same intensity. On surfaces meant to be brought forward as a whole — a textured wall, stone cladding or a picture wall — a wall washer is the right choice.

Which IP rating is needed outdoors?

Fittings exposed directly to rain need IP65 or above. In sheltered places such as under an eave, IP44 may be sufficient. In coastal areas with salt in the air, look at the body material as well — an aluminium body does not rust.

How far from the wall is a wall washer placed?

The general rule is to set the fitting away from the wall by about a quarter of the ceiling height. Placing it too close leaves a bright band at the top of the wall and darkness below, and spoils the evenness.

What spacing should there be between fittings in a corridor?

With a standard ceiling height of 2.4–2.7 m, a spacing of 2–2.5 m gives a balanced rhythm in most cases. As the spacing opens up, dark gaps appear on the wall and the row of light looks broken. As the ceiling rises, the spacing can open up too, depending on the beam angle of the fitting.

Can a wall light illuminate a room on its own?

No. The job of a wall light is to emphasise a surface or a corner and give the space depth. General lighting should come from the ceiling, with the wall light adding a layer on top. Substituting one for the other produces either glare or too little light.

What do the two digits in IP65 mean?

The first digit covers protection against solid objects (dust), the second against water. In IP65 the 6 means complete dust-tightness and the 5 means resistance to water jets from any direction. On a fitting that will meet a hose during garden watering, the second digit is the decisive one.
